Course structure

• Introduction to 3D Modeling for Urban Regeneration • Principles of Urban Planning and Design • Site Analysis and Data Collection Methods • 3D Visualization Tools and Software • Modeling Techniques for Urban Spaces • Sustainable Design Practices in Urban Regeneration • Virtual Reality and Augmented Reality Applications • Collaboration and Communication in Urban Development Projects
